Output 0d8fc316f8d23f1624e5ebbcd2b594c1b071f1706f2ba8bda769f8c6c5791e67:7

value
37780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ab89dae00644393eaff073c56dd03637d91deeb0 OP_EQUAL
address
3HL2cgKYk2ejA96Vw1jNbdXdbGhDPCdPwg
transaction
0d8fc316f8d23f1624e5ebbcd2b594c1b071f1706f2ba8bda769f8c6c5791e67
spent
true